Q: Is 137,750 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 137,750 is a composite number.

Why is 137,750 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 137,750 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 19 25 29 38 50 58 95 125 145 190 250 290 475 551 725 950 1,102 1,450 2,375 2,755 3,625 4,750 5,510 7,250 13,775 27,550 68,875 and 137,750, with no remainder.

Since 137,750 cannot be divided by just 1 and 137,750, it is a composite number.
